Variables Affecting Repair Work Costs
When considering roof covering repair work expenses, a number of crucial aspects enter play that can considerably impact your budget.
Initially, the sort of roof covering material you've picked influences the overall expense. Asphalt roof shingles, for example, usually cost much less to fix than slate or floor tile roofs.
Next off, the size of the area that requires repair is crucial. Bigger sections will normally need more materials and labor, increasing expenses.
The degree of the damages likewise matters. Small leakages could just require patching, while considerable damage might demand a complete substitute of shingles and even architectural repairs.
Additionally, your place plays a role; locations with high labor prices or certain building codes might see raised costs.
Weather can likewise affect the timeline and price, as repair work in harsh climates may require specific tools or materials.
Lastly, the service provider you pick influences prices, so it's important to obtain multiple quotes.
Each of these factors can shift your roof fixing prices, so recognizing them assists you prepare for the economic commitment ahead.
Approximating Your Repair Budget
Approximating your repair budget needs a mindful evaluation of both the instant costs and prospective unanticipated costs. Beginning by gathering quotes from regional contractors. These first price quotes will certainly offer you a standard for the job needed.
Look closely at the materials and labor costs, as these can vary significantly between providers.
Next off, think about the age and problem of your roof. If it's aging, you could want to factor in the opportunity of added repair work that can emerge as soon as work starts. For example, covert damages might be found once the shingles are removed, leading to boosted prices.
It's important to reserve an extra 10-20% of your allocate these unanticipated issues.
Don't forget to consist of any required permits or assessments in your budget. These can contribute to your general expenses but are essential for conformity and safety.
Last but not least, consider just how the timing of your repair can affect prices. Off-season repairs may be less costly, so strategy appropriately.
Tips for Cost-Effective Repairs
Discovering means to minimize roofing repairs can make a considerable difference in your general spending plan. Beginning by assessing the damages on your own prior to calling a professional. You may recognize small issues that you can deal with without help, like replacing a couple of shingles or securing small leaks.
Next off, think about scheduling repairs throughout the off-season. Specialists frequently offer lower prices during slower months, so timing your repair services can save you cash. Constantly obtain multiple quotes from different professionals; this provides you a better idea of fair pricing and enables you to work out.
Additionally, purchase regular upkeep to stop larger problems down the line. Simple tasks like cleaning up rain gutters and examining your roofing can expand its lifespan and conserve you from pricey fixings.
Ultimately, explore DIY options for little repair work. Lots of on-line resources offer detailed overviews, making it much easier than ever to deal with minor issues on your own. Simply ensure you have the best security equipment and tools before starting.
